If you need help shopping for Christmas presents and you happen to have TV fans on your list, we're here to help!
The obvious gift choice for the TV addicts on your shopping list is a TV show on dvd. But which one?
Well, the N&O staff voted on the dvd sets they'd most like to get from Santa this year, and the overwhelming favorite was HBO's critically acclaimed crime series, "The Wire." We can't argue with that.
Second place was a three-way tie between "House," "Lost," and "Monk." Other shows getting multiple votes were "The Andy Griffith Show," "Dexter," "Glee," "NCIS," "The Office," "Seinfeld," and "West Wing."

Is someone in your house an "NCIS" fan? It's the number one show in the country, so odds are the answer to that question is "yes." Help that fan look like Leroy Jethro and the gang with their very own official NCIS agent cap. You can get this from the CBS store.
These "Dexter" bloodslide coasters are the perfect gift for the strange person on your shopping list. "Dexter" fans will recognize the coasters as the good-guy-serial-killer's trophy collection. While you're at the Showtime shop, there's some cool stuff for "Weeds" fans too.
If the strange people on your list are more "vampirey" than "serial killery," may we suggest some Tru Blood drink for the HBO "True Blood" fans. These bottled drinks are designed to look just like the synthetic blood drinks enjoyed by Vampire Bill on the show. The flavor is "blood orange" and has a slightly tart taste. You can get different sizes and combinations, but the Ultimate Party Pack comes with 24 14-oz bottles, 8 Tru Blood logo pint glasses, and a Tru Blood bottle opener. On sale for only $169.99.
